About the role
The Transition Specialist plays a crucial role in assisting youth transitioning out of foster care by providing comprehensive case management services, advocating for their needs, and ensuring compliance with regulatory guidelines.
Responsibilities
- Assess personal needs and secure resources for clients
- Advocate for clients with various human services and legal systems
- Provide crisis intervention and develop action plans for youth
- Create and maintain detailed Individual Service Plans
- Maintain accurate and timely file documentation
- Follow HHS guidelines and policies related to PAL TFSS services
- Participate in and lead PAL program events and activities
- Work evenings or weekends as needed
- Implement BCFS HHS safety protocols
- Obtain necessary authorizations and approvals
- Show knowledge of community resources and demonstrate confidentiality
- Record services and activities accurately and report any suspected abuse
- Maintain professional and ethical standards
- Attend required trainings and comply with dress code
- Travel as needed
Requirements
- Maintain relevant certifications (First Aid, CPR)
- Hold a valid Texas driver’s license with a clear record
- Pass a pre-employment drug screen and background check
- Produce proof of work eligibility
- Be bilingual (Spanish required)
